Transaction 9310106dfddb035b1ff0c300bdc618c0d25c23e0d92dc759d1afdc17005b0762
1 Input
2 Outputs
- 9310106dfddb035b1ff0c300bdc618c0d25c23e0d92dc759d1afdc17005b0762:0
- 9310106dfddb035b1ff0c300bdc618c0d25c23e0d92dc759d1afdc17005b0762:1
value 1000000
address 1Lx4n4P2EYHhW2SyrkPLunWcr85KkU947W
value 976044
address 12FcDZbjm6BtznDVDLbcRsMMjYrCSkcrSg